Output 57824c7094def566f4f5c3654cc3f96307c0460ce1f0f6334e2ce4fe73fbb1cf:31

value
19325130
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6100f6fe5f7f0d5cea69c3849c4c9ab20fec3bd3 OP_EQUALVERIFY OP_CHECKSIG
address
19quheNaQTLR3f8p9qHvgjUStqEHH9XLK2
transaction
57824c7094def566f4f5c3654cc3f96307c0460ce1f0f6334e2ce4fe73fbb1cf
confirmations
671786
spent
true